    MSG pro-tip (applies to others as well, to some extent): Wait until week/day of show to buy tickets. Stage gets built and venue realizes they can sell additional side lowers that were held back. Worked great for the MSG shows in NOV, and others have mentioned the same for other MSG shows. Probably old new to many, but MSG seems to hold back an unusually large number of side lowers.

    They have been doing dynamic for a while, like juuuuust before COVID hit. Those early 2020 tours announced in Jan/Feb/March 2020 had dynamic for some shows (My Chemical Romance tour, etc). Saw it on TM but noticed DMB hasn't done it all. They do the platinum tickets which are absolutely absurd but at least those are only a few rows of the venue.
